The Health Risks of Rodent Contamination in Your Duct System in Harrisburg, SD

Hantavirus — The Most Serious Risk in Harrisburg

Hantavirus pulmonary syndrome is caused by hantaviruses carried primarily by deer mice in Harrisburg, SD. The virus is shed in droppings, urine, and saliva. Human infection occurs primarily through inhalation of aerosolized viral particles from disturbed dried rodent waste in Harrisburg. A duct system with rodent droppings that runs the HVAC aerosolizes dried waste and distributes it throughout the home in Harrisburg, SD. Hantavirus pulmonary syndrome has a significant fatality rate among confirmed cases in Harrisburg.

Salmonella and Bacterial Contamination in Harrisburg, SD

Rodent droppings can carry salmonella and other bacterial pathogens in Harrisburg. Other bacterial pathogens associated with rodent waste include leptospira bacteria that cause leptospirosis in Harrisburg, SD. Antimicrobial decontamination treatment following thorough physical removal addresses bacterial contamination on the cleaned duct surfaces in Harrisburg.

Allergic Reactions to Rodent Allergens in Harrisburg

Rodent dander, urine proteins, and droppings are significant allergens for sensitized individuals in Harrisburg, SD. The HVAC has been distributing rodent allergen proteins throughout the home with every cycle in Harrisburg. Occupants with rodent allergies experience persistent allergic symptoms when the duct system carries rodent allergen contamination in Harrisburg, SD.

Secondary Pest Infestation in Harrisburg, SD

Rodent activity in duct systems attracts secondary pests in Harrisburg. Insects and mites that parasitize rodents can infest the duct system and surrounding areas after the rodents have departed or been exterminated in Harrisburg, SD. Complete removal of all rodent waste and nesting material eliminates the food and habitat source for secondary pest infestation in Harrisburg.

Signs of Rodent Contamination in Your Air Duct System in Harrisburg, SD

Visible Droppings in or Around Vents in Harrisburg

Rodent droppings at register openings or on duct surfaces when a register is removed are direct confirmation of rodent activity in Harrisburg, SD. Mouse droppings are approximately the size and shape of a grain of rice in Harrisburg. Both mouse and rat droppings indicate active or recent rodent presence in the duct system in Harrisburg, SD.

Nesting Material at Register Openings in Harrisburg, SD

Nesting material including insulation fibers, paper, fabric, and plant material at register openings indicates active or recent rodent nesting in the duct system in Harrisburg. The visible nesting material is the portion accessible at the register opening — the bulk is further in the duct system in Harrisburg, SD.

Gnaw Marks on Ductwork or Insulation in Harrisburg

Gnaw marks on flexible ductwork, on duct insulation in attics or crawl spaces, or on plastic duct components indicate rodent activity in or near the duct system in Harrisburg, SD. Rodents chew to create or enlarge entry points and gather nesting material in Harrisburg.

Rodent Odor From Vents During HVAC Operation in Harrisburg, SD

A musky rodent odor from supply registers during HVAC operation indicates active rodent presence or significant rodent waste accumulation in the duct system in Harrisburg. A decomposition odor indicates a deceased rodent in the duct system in Harrisburg, SD.

Activity Near the Air Handler in Harrisburg

Droppings, gnaw marks, or nesting material near the air handler cabinet indicate that rodents have accessed or are attempting to access the HVAC system at the air handler in Harrisburg, SD. Air handlers are a common rodent entry point because they provide access to the complete duct network from a single location in Harrisburg.

Why HEPA Filtration Is Required for Rodent Contamination Work in Harrisburg, SD

The filtration in standard duct cleaning equipment may not capture the finest particles of dried rodent waste including the viral and bacterial particles associated with hantavirus and other pathogens in Harrisburg. HEPA filtration captures particles down to 0.3 microns with 99.97 percent efficiency in Harrisburg, SD. HEPA-equipped vacuum equipment is the appropriate standard for rodent contamination work because it captures the particle sizes associated with the relevant health risks in Harrisburg.

Hantavirus pulmonary syndrome is a serious respiratory illness caused by hantaviruses carried by certain rodent species in Harrisburg. The virus is shed in rodent droppings, urine, and saliva and becomes airborne when dried rodent waste is disturbed and aerosolized in Harrisburg, SD. A duct system with rodent droppings that runs the HVAC aerosolizes dried waste and distributes it throughout the home in Harrisburg. Hantavirus pulmonary syndrome has a significant fatality rate among confirmed cases in Harrisburg, SD.
No. Running the HVAC with rodent contaminated ducts distributes dried rodent waste particles and associated pathogens to every room in the home in Harrisburg. Stop the HVAC immediately and call American Air Duct for same-day scheduling in Harrisburg, SD. If stopping the HVAC is not possible due to temperature conditions, minimize cycling frequency while awaiting service in Harrisburg.
The CDC recommends against dry sweeping or vacuuming rodent droppings without respiratory protection because this approach aerosolizes the dried waste and creates inhalation exposure in Harrisburg. If you must handle rodent waste before professional decontamination, the CDC recommends wearing gloves and a properly fitted N95 respirator and wetting the droppings with disinfectant before handling to reduce aerosolization in Harrisburg, SD.
